#include "idchangelog.h"
#include <kdebug.h>
IDChangeLog::IDChangeLog() {}
IDChangeLog::IDChangeLog(const IDChangeLog& Other) {
m_LogArray = Other.m_LogArray;
}
IDChangeLog::~IDChangeLog() {}
IDChangeLog& IDChangeLog::operator=(const IDChangeLog& Other) {
m_LogArray = Other.m_LogArray;
return *this;
}
bool IDChangeLog::operator==(const IDChangeLog& /*Other*/) {
/*It needs to be Implemented*/
return false;
}
Uml::IDType IDChangeLog::findNewID(Uml::IDType OldID) {
uint count = m_LogArray.size();
for(uint i = 0; i < count; i++) {
if((m_LogArray.point(i)).y() == OldID) {
return (m_LogArray.point(i)).x();
}
}
return Uml::id_None;
}
IDChangeLog& IDChangeLog::operator+=(const IDChangeLog& Other) {
//m_LogArray.putpoints(m_LogArray.size(), Other.m_LogArray.size(), Other)
uint count = Other.m_LogArray.size();
for(uint i = 0; i < count; i++) {
addIDChange((Other.m_LogArray.point(i)).y(), (Other.m_LogArray.point(i)).x());
}
return *this;
}
void IDChangeLog::addIDChange(Uml::IDType OldID, Uml::IDType NewID) {
uint pos;
if(!findIDChange(OldID, NewID, pos)) {
pos = m_LogArray.size();
m_LogArray.resize(pos + 1);
m_LogArray.setPoint(pos, NewID, OldID);
} else {
m_LogArray.setPoint(pos, NewID, OldID);
}
}
Uml::IDType IDChangeLog::findOldID(Uml::IDType NewID) {
uint count = m_LogArray.size();
for(uint i = 0; i < count; i++) {
if((m_LogArray.point(i)).x() == NewID) {
return (m_LogArray.point(i)).y();
}
}
return Uml::id_None;
}
bool IDChangeLog::findIDChange(Uml::IDType OldID, Uml::IDType NewID, uint& pos) {
uint count = m_LogArray.size();
for(uint i = 0; i < count; i++) {
if(((m_LogArray.point(i)).y() == OldID) && ((m_LogArray.point(i)).x() == NewID)) {
pos = i;
return true;
}
}
return false;
}
void IDChangeLog::removeChangeByNewID(Uml::IDType OldID) {
uint count = m_LogArray.size();
for(uint i = 0; i < count; i++) {
if((m_LogArray.point(i)).y() == OldID) {
m_LogArray.setPoint(i, Uml::id_None, OldID);
}
}
}
